Abstract
A raw aluminum foil for use to prepare electrolytic condenser electrodes has an aluminum purity of 99.9% or higher and contains 50-500 ppm of Mg. A method of etching the raw foil to prepare the electrodes consists of a primary etching step and a secondary etching step, and the primary etching is conducted in an aqueous bath containing 3-10% by weight of HCl and 10-40% by weight of H.sub.2 SO.sub.4, at 70.degree.-90.degree. C. and with a current density of 10-40 A/dm.sup.2. The secondary etching is conducted electrolytically or chemically in a further bath containing 3-10% by weight of HCl, with or without 1% or less of H.sub.2 C.sub.2 O.sub.4 added to the further bath, at a bath temperature of 70.degree.-95.degree. C. and with a current density of 0-10 A/dm.sup.2.
